Electrical Discharge Machining(EDM),Advanced Manufacturing Technology,What Is EDM?,EDM is a machining method primarily used for hard metals or those that would be impossible to machine with traditional techniques. One critical limitation, however, is that EDM only works with materials that are electrically conductive. EDM or Electrical Discharge Machining, is especially well-suited for cutting intricate contours or delicate cavities that would be difficult to produce with a grinder, an end mill or other cutting tools. Metals that can be machined with EDM include hastalloy, hardened tool-steel, titanium, carbide, inconel and kovar. EDM is sometimes called “spark machining“ because it removes metal by producing a rapid series of repetitive electrical discharges. These electrical discharges are passed between anelectrode and the piece of metal being machined. The small amount of material that is removed from the workpiece is flushed away with a continuously flowing fluid. The repetitive discharges create a set of successively deeper craters in the work piece until the final shape is produced. There are two primary EDM methods: ram EDM and wire EDM. The primary difference between the two involves the electrode that is used to perform the machining. In a typical ram EDMapplication, a graphite electrode is machined with traditional tools. The now specially-shaped electrode is connected to the power source, attached to a ram, and slowly fed into the workpiece. The entire machining operation is usually performed while submerged in a fluid bath. The fluid serves the following three purposes:,Advanced Manufacturing Technology,Electrical Discharge Machining(EDM),flushes material away serves as a coolant to minimize the heat affected zone, thereby preventing potential damage to the workpiece acts as a conductor for the current to pass between the electrode and the workpiece.,Advanced Manufacturing Technology,Electrical Discharge Machining(EDM),In wire EDM a very thin wire serves as the electrode. Special brass wires are typically used; the wire is slowly fed through the material and the electrical discharges actually cut the workpiece. Wire EDM is usually performed in a bath of water. If someone was to observe the wire EDM process under a microscope, he would discover that the wire itself does not actually touch the metal to be cut; the electrical discharges actually remove small amounts of material and allow the wire to be moved through the workpiece. The path of the wire is typically controlled by a computer, which allows extremely complex shapes to be produced. Perhaps the best way to explain wire EDM is to use an analogy. Imagine a thin metal wire stretched between two hands, slid though a block of cheese, cutting any shape desired. The positions of the hands can be alterred on either side of the cheese to define complex and curved shapes. Wire EDM works in a similar fashion, except electrical discharge machining can handle some of the hardest materials used in industry. Also note that, in dragging a wire through cheese, the wire is actually displacing the cheese as it cuts, but in EDM, a thin kerf is created by removing tiny particles of metal. Electrical discharge machining is frequently used to make dies and molds. It has recently become a standard method of producing prototypes and some production parts, particularly in low volume applications. The power supply controls the electrical discharges and movement of the electrode in relation to the workpiece. During operation the workpiece is submerged in a bath of dielectric fluid (electrically nonconducting). (Die-Sinking EDM is also called Sinker, Ram-Type, Conventional, Plunge or Vertical EDM),EDM Die-Sinking (Plunge),Advanced Manufacturing Technology,The spark discharges are pulsed on and off at a high frequency cycle and can repeat 250,000 times per second. Each discharge melts or vaporizes a small area of the workpiece surface.,During normal operation the electrode never touches the workpiece, but is separated by a small spark gap.,The amount of material removed from the workpiece with each pulse is directly proportional to the energy it contains.,The electrode (plunger) can be a complex shape, and can be moved in X, Y, and Z axes, as well as rotated, enabling more complex shapes with accuracy better than one mil.,Plunge EDM is best used in tool and die manufacturing, or creating extremely accurate molds for injection-molding plastic parts.,Electrical Discharge Machining(EDM),Advanced Manufacturing Technology,A relatively soft graphite or metallic electrode can easily machine hardened tool steels or tungsten carbide. One of the many attractive benefits of using the EDM process.,The dielectric fluid performs the following functions: It acts as an insulator until sufficiently high potential is reached . Acts as a coolant medium and reduces the extremely high temp. in the arc gap.
